Directions
- Season Chicken: Start by lightly seasoning the chicken pieces with salt and pepper. This simple step enhances the flavor, preparing your chicken for delicious frying.
- Mix Batter: In a mixing bowl, combine the eggs, cornstarch, and flour. Whisk together until you achieve a smooth batter, which will give the chicken its fabulous crunch once fried.
- Coat Chicken: Dip each chicken piece into the batter, making sure it’s evenly coated. This will create a delightful, crispy outer layer that’s essential for that perfect bite.
- Fry Chicken: Heat oil in a pan over medium-high heat. Carefully add the battered chicken pieces and fry until they’re golden brown and crisp, about 5-7 minutes. Drain on paper towels to remove excess oil.
- Simmer Sauce: In a separate saucepan, combine the lemon juice, lemon zest, sugar, chicken stock, soy sauce, garlic, and ginger. Simmer over low heat for about 5-7 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together beautifully.
- Thicken Sauce: Create a cornstarch slurry with a little water and add it to the simmering sauce. Stir until the sauce thickens and becomes glossy—just perfect for drizzling over your chicken.
- Combine Chicken and Sauce: Toss the crispy chicken pieces in the thickened sauce until they’re well coated or drizzle the sauce over the top when serving. Both options taste fantastic!

Notes
Optional: Sprinkle with sesame seeds for a lovely garnish. Ensure chicken pieces are cut into uniform sizes for even cooking. Avoid overcrowding the pan while frying for crispy chicken.
